Regular inspections are very important to understanding the condition of your fence. This means checking for any signs of damage and tear, corresponding to rust, rot, or important discoloration. Every part of the fence ought to be scrutinized, together with gates and latching mechanisms. Damaged or compromised sections can render a pool fence much less efficient. Conducting a radical inspection initially of every swimming season might help catch points early, earlier than the fence turns into a security hazard.
Cleaning is one other elementary element of pool fence maintenance. Depending on the material of the fence—be it wood, vinyl, or aluminum—cleaning strategies will range. For instance, wooden fences would possibly require energy washing to get rid of grime and forestall mould progress, while vinyl choices generally need simple cleaning soap and water. Regular cleansing prevents buildup that may lead to corrosion or decay, ensuring the fence's integrity over time.
It's additionally important to hold up the encompassing area of the pool fence. Overgrown vegetation can hinder visibility and even injury the construction by way of roots and vines. Keeping the area clear allows for simpler inspections and enhances the general appearance of the yard. In addition, a clean perimeter discourages pests that may nest in or around the fence, creating extra maintenance issues.

Pay consideration to the gate of your pool fence, as it's usually the most utilized and worn component. Regularly test the latch and hinges to ensure they perform accurately with out sticking. A gate that doesn’t close correctly can pose a major risk, notably with babies. If any a part of the gate appears problematic, repairs ought to take priority to make sure there aren't any security vulnerabilities.
Consider the effects of weather in your pool fence. Harsh winters can lead to frost injury, whereas hot summers can warp picket structures. Take preventive measures by using weather-resistant finishes or remedies. This is very essential in areas that experience extreme temperatures, as totally different components can adversely affect various supplies.
In the case of metal fences, search for indicators of rust. The presence of rust not only affects the aesthetic appeal of the fence however also can weaken its structural integrity. There are several strategies to treat rust, including sanding down the affected areas and making use of rust-inhibiting paint. Regularly checking for rust and treating it as needed will extend the life of a metallic fence considerably.
For these with vinyl pool fences, perceive that whereas this material is generally more resistant to the elements, it could nonetheless turn into discolored from UV exposure. Routine washing can help keep its look, however investing in UV-protective therapies is sensible for long-term upkeep. Protecting vinyl helps be positive that its colour remains vibrant for many seasons to come.

Another facet of pool fence upkeep involves the landscaping around the pool area. Installing ornamental rocks, gravel, or mulch throughout the neighborhood of the fence not solely provides to the magnificence of the world but in addition limits the expansion of grass and weeds which will complicate upkeep. A neat and well-maintained panorama results in higher visibility for parents supervising children around the pool.
Investing in a quality pool fence means contemplating the longevity of its options. Upgrading parts like latches, hinges, and gates to greater quality versions can improve functionality and security. When these components become excessively worn, they can compromise the overall effectiveness of your safety barrier. Regularly assess the need for upgrades to make sure the system stays intact and operational.

- Regularly inspect the fence for any loose or broken panels, changing them promptly to ensure safety and integrity.
- Clean the fence floor with a mild detergent and water to remove dust, algae, and other debris that may degrade materials over time.
- Lubricate hinges, latches, and different transferring components to forestall rust and ensure clean operation of gates.
- Check for any obstructions close to the fence perimeter that might compromise its effectiveness or stability, removing potential hazards as needed.
- Ensure that the fence bars or panels are spaced appropriately to adapt to native safety rules, minimizing the risk of accidental access.
- Seal wood fences with weather-resistant finishes to guard towards moisture and solar damage, prolonging the lifespan of the supplies.
- Schedule annual professional inspections for metal fences to assess and address any rust or corrosion that will have developed.
- Maintain the landscaping around the fence to forestall foliage from urgent against the structure, which can lead to scratches and structural points.
- Consider installing a pool alarm system at the aspect of the fence to add a further layer of security for children and pets.
